Yeah but your equity is awarded based on internal valuation. Ask them what that is from most recent 409A. For example, instacart slashed their internal valuation from recent public raise by 40%.
How much cash do they have and how quickly are they burning through it? Do they have enough cash to get to IPO? If not, how do you think they would fare raising money in a recession?
Ask how fast they’re hiring and how the team is structured that you’re joining. Very fast hiring (e.g doubling / tripling staff) could lead to layoffs if cash gets tighter / as they figure out the org model.
